Wednesday, the Federal Open Market Committee left the target Federal Funds Rate unchanged at 5.25%-5.50%. In a statement released just at 2PM, the committee said inflation has eased, but it can only expect to reduce the target range when they have more confidence inflation has lowered for good.

"In recent months, there has been a lack of further progress toward the Committee’s 2 percent inflation objective," the Committee said. "The Committee would be prepared to adjust the stance of monetary policy as appropriate if risks emerge that could impede the attainment of the Committee’s goals."

Fed's Jerome Powell is expected to speak before a press conference at 2:30 PM EST
